logo Debian Debian Debian-France Debian-Facile Debian-fr.org Forum-Debian.fr Debian ? Communautés logo inclusivité

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#1 24-04-2023 17:33:40

brennux
Adhérent(e)
Lieu : France
Distrib. : Debian-facile 11 (bullseye)
Noyau : 5.10.0-26-amd64
(G)UI : Xfce
Inscription : 21-04-2020

[Résolu] Serveur web localhost, comment fait-on ?

Bonjour,
la question fera sourire les chenus, celles et ceux qui ont des cals sous les doigts…

Venant de Mac OS, j'utilise MAMP, un "tout-en-un" pour créer des maquettes web sur mon ordi actuel. Je pars d'un environnement où beaucoup d'éléments de facilitation sont intégrés, mon apprentissage technique est donc léger, en partie biaisé.

Je n'ai pas trouvé de plan clair, écrit en une langue qui m'est familère, pour comprendre comment on procède dans un contexte Linux.

L'article du wiki propose une pente un peu raide pour [re]débuter.

Avez-vous des pistes pour que je puisse retourner sur les bancs sans trop de douleurs ?

Merci

Dernière modification par brennux (14-07-2023 18:37:41)


Aucune idole, vivante, statufiée ou immatérielle.
Xfce, style Numix, icônes Tango

Hors ligne

#2 24-04-2023 17:53:34

otyugh
CA Debian-Facile
Lieu : Quimperlé/Arzano
Distrib. : Debian Stable
Inscription : 20-09-2016
Site Web

Re : [Résolu] Serveur web localhost, comment fait-on ?

Y a plusieurs manières et teeeeellement plein de tutos. Tu as un peu aucune autre excuse que d'avoir trop l'embarras du choix T_T

Tl;dr en deux minute de recherche de la manière la plus évidente (mais pas forcément celle que tu veux) :

apt install apache2
#paf tu as un serveur web qui sert tout ce qui se trouve dans /var/www/html/ quand tu va à http://localhost
apt install php php-cli libapache2-mod-php
#paf le serveur web peut maintenant servir du .php
apt install php-mysql mariadb-server
mysql_secure_installation
#paf le serveur web peut maintenant utiliser une base de donnée



Sachant que selon tes besoins, juste la première ligne suffit pour servir des pages statiques en html...

Note : j'ai absolument rien testé (j'utilise nginx depuis des années et j'ai pas eu besoin de remettre les doigts dedans) mais ça m'a l'air cohérent ? wink

Dernière modification par otyugh (24-04-2023 17:55:47)


virtue_signaling.pngpalestine.png
~1821942.svg

Hors ligne

#3 24-04-2023 20:55:03

brennux
Adhérent(e)
Lieu : France
Distrib. : Debian-facile 11 (bullseye)
Noyau : 5.10.0-26-amd64
(G)UI : Xfce
Inscription : 21-04-2020

Re : [Résolu] Serveur web localhost, comment fait-on ?

otyugh a écrit :

Y a plusieurs manières et teeeeellement plein de tutos. Tu as un peu aucune autre excuse que d'avoir trop l'embarras du choix T_T

Tl;dr en deux minute de recherche de la manière la plus évidente (mais pas forcément celle que tu veux) :

apt install apache2
#paf tu as un serveur web qui sert tout ce qui se trouve dans /var/www/html/ quand tu va à http://localhost
apt install php php-cli libapache2-mod-php
#paf le serveur web peut maintenant servir du .php
apt install php-mysql mariadb-server
mysql_secure_installation
#paf le serveur web peut maintenant utiliser une base de donnée



Sachant que selon tes besoins, juste la première ligne suffit pour servir des pages statiques en html...

Note : j'ai absolument rien testé (j'utilise nginx depuis des années et j'ai pas eu besoin de remettre les doigts dedans) mais ça m'a l'air cohérent ? wink


Merci @otyugh !

Simple, court, cohérent. Si j'ai bien compris, on se passe des applications du type XAMPP, MAMP, en ajoutant au système juste ce qui manque pour avoir un serveur local.

plein de tutos

certes, j'en ai trouvé des pelletées. Mais je souhaite comprendre, ne pas mettre pas le bren dans le système. Ce qui me manque encore, n'ayant pour le moment que très peu d'investigations éclairantes au compteur. Les lumières d'ici m'aident bien.


Aucune idole, vivante, statufiée ou immatérielle.
Xfce, style Numix, icônes Tango

Hors ligne

#4 24-04-2023 21:41:29

otyugh
CA Debian-Facile
Lieu : Quimperlé/Arzano
Distrib. : Debian Stable
Inscription : 20-09-2016
Site Web

Re : [Résolu] Serveur web localhost, comment fait-on ?

ajoutant au système juste ce qui manque pour avoir un serveur local.


Yup !

Après c'est pas forcément si simple à installer, parfois y a une ligne de configuration à ajouter pour que ça tourne (genre dire à apache "utilise php quand le fichier que tu sert finit par .php"). Le premier tuto sur lequel je suis tombé n'en parlait pas - donc j'assume que c'est la config par défaut, mais si jamais ça marche pas comme prévu... Cherche "LAMP debian" sur un tuto récent et tu devrai trouver quelque chose qu'a pas été écrit en cinq minute par quelqu'un qui n'utilise pas apache (et je vais pas tout faire à ta place, ça serait pas te faire cadeau, essaye d'abord ! Reviens si tu coinces. Fais en un article dans le wiki si tu penses pourvoir l'expliquer à la prochaine personne avec ce besoin ~)

Dernière modification par otyugh (24-04-2023 21:50:59)


virtue_signaling.pngpalestine.png
~1821942.svg

Hors ligne

#5 24-04-2023 21:50:31

brennux
Adhérent(e)
Lieu : France
Distrib. : Debian-facile 11 (bullseye)
Noyau : 5.10.0-26-amd64
(G)UI : Xfce
Inscription : 21-04-2020

Re : [Résolu] Serveur web localhost, comment fait-on ?

Non, je n'attends pas que tu fasses le boulot à ma place. Rien que les bonnes clés de recherche m'orientent déjà très bien et je t'en remercie.

Dès que la machine sera opérationnelle, je pourrai m'atteler à la tâche.

Aucune idole, vivante, statufiée ou immatérielle.
Xfce, style Numix, icônes Tango

Hors ligne

#6 25-04-2023 08:16:16

bendia
Chadministrateur
Distrib. : openSUSE Tumbleweed, Buster
Noyau : Linux 5.9.1-2-default + Linux 4.19.0-12-amd64
(G)UI : Gnome + Console et un peu Fluxbox
Inscription : 20-03-2012
Site Web

Re : [Résolu] Serveur web localhost, comment fait-on ?

otyugh a écrit :

Fais en un article dans le wiki si tu penses pourvoir l'expliquer à la prochaine personne avec ce besoin

Nous en sommes en plein dans la mise à jour du wiki et on peut voir sur la page Etat du Wiki qu'il y a un tuto sur LAMP en chantier depuis 2019 qui aurait probablement besoin d'être repris avec les dernières infos sur les logiciels mis en œuvre et terminé afin d'être placé smile


Ben
___________________
La seule question bête, c'est celle qu'on ne pose pas.

En ligne

#7 25-04-2023 15:36:17

cyrille
CA Debian-Facile
Lieu : Nowhere
Distrib. : SID + FreeBSD. Stable sur serveurs.
(G)UI : Xfce/Openbox
Inscription : 21-06-2020
Site Web

Re : [Résolu] Serveur web localhost, comment fait-on ?

Hello
Basé sur nginx
https://debian-facile.org/atelier:chant … s-de-php?s[]=cyrille
Si ça peut servir wink

"Ils ne me comprennent point, je ne suis pas la bouche qu’il faut à ces oreilles."

Association Debian-Facile | Les cahiers du débutant | ISO Debian-FacilePage perso. sur #df

Hors ligne

#8 25-04-2023 15:48:34

ubub
Membre
Distrib. : Debian
(G)UI : xfce
Inscription : 14-05-2019

Re : [Résolu] Serveur web localhost, comment fait-on ?

cyrille a écrit :

Hello
Basé sur nginx


et mariaBD ...?.. smile

En ligne

#9 25-04-2023 15:57:01

cyrille
CA Debian-Facile
Lieu : Nowhere
Distrib. : SID + FreeBSD. Stable sur serveurs.
(G)UI : Xfce/Openbox
Inscription : 21-06-2020
Site Web

Re : [Résolu] Serveur web localhost, comment fait-on ?

oui wink

"Ils ne me comprennent point, je ne suis pas la bouche qu’il faut à ces oreilles."

Association Debian-Facile | Les cahiers du débutant | ISO Debian-FacilePage perso. sur #df

Hors ligne

#10 25-04-2023 16:08:38

brennux
Adhérent(e)
Lieu : France
Distrib. : Debian-facile 11 (bullseye)
Noyau : 5.10.0-26-amd64
(G)UI : Xfce
Inscription : 21-04-2020

Re : [Résolu] Serveur web localhost, comment fait-on ?

cyrille a écrit :

Hello
Basé sur nginx
https://debian-facile.org/atelier:chant … s-de-php?s[]=cyrille
Si ça peut servir wink


Merci. En tous cas, ça me familiarise petit à petit avec le vocabulaire, les commandes, l'organisation de tout ça. Très instructif.


Aucune idole, vivante, statufiée ou immatérielle.
Xfce, style Numix, icônes Tango

Hors ligne

#11 25-04-2023 16:10:04

cyrille
CA Debian-Facile
Lieu : Nowhere
Distrib. : SID + FreeBSD. Stable sur serveurs.
(G)UI : Xfce/Openbox
Inscription : 21-06-2020
Site Web

Re : [Résolu] Serveur web localhost, comment fait-on ?

Sinon si tu veux vraiment apache (perso j'ai un faible pour nginx), j'avais écrit ça pour Linux Mint (mais aussi LMDE) donc ça devrait passer sur debian
https://forum-francophone-linuxmint.fr/ … 2&p=148999

"Ils ne me comprennent point, je ne suis pas la bouche qu’il faut à ces oreilles."

Association Debian-Facile | Les cahiers du débutant | ISO Debian-FacilePage perso. sur #df

Hors ligne

#12 25-04-2023 16:51:37

otyugh
CA Debian-Facile
Lieu : Quimperlé/Arzano
Distrib. : Debian Stable
Inscription : 20-09-2016
Site Web

Re : [Résolu] Serveur web localhost, comment fait-on ?

Pareil je suis chez nginx (parce que c'était réputé plus léger). Après Apache est généralement "la norme" donné, et ça supporte les .htaccess dont certains moteur de site dépendent, donc... Quand quelqu'un nage dans le flou, j'aborde plutôt Apache.


Non, je n'attends pas que tu fasses le boulot à ma place


Et c'était pas à prendre comme une critique hein, je t'invitais juste à faire des questions plus concrètes, du genre "j'ai tenté X et je bloque en le faisant". ^^'

Dernière modification par otyugh (25-04-2023 17:38:23)


virtue_signaling.pngpalestine.png
~1821942.svg

Hors ligne

#13 26-04-2023 08:48:40

brennux
Adhérent(e)
Lieu : France
Distrib. : Debian-facile 11 (bullseye)
Noyau : 5.10.0-26-amd64
(G)UI : Xfce
Inscription : 21-04-2020

Re : [Résolu] Serveur web localhost, comment fait-on ?

otyugh a écrit :

[…]

Et c'était pas à prendre comme une critique hein, je t'invitais juste à faire des questions plus concrètes, du genre "j'ai tenté X et je bloque en le faisant". ^^'


Bonjour,
pas de souci, je ne l'avais pas pris ainsi.
Je comprends la démarche, je fais aussi du support sur d'autres forums cool
Les questions concrètes viendront sans aucun doute, mais sans machine opérationnelle sous Linux, ça reste assez théorique pour le moment. Encore quelques semaines et je pourrai me mettre au travail.


Aucune idole, vivante, statufiée ou immatérielle.
Xfce, style Numix, icônes Tango

Hors ligne

#14 26-04-2023 08:52:46

brennux
Adhérent(e)
Lieu : France
Distrib. : Debian-facile 11 (bullseye)
Noyau : 5.10.0-26-amd64
(G)UI : Xfce
Inscription : 21-04-2020

Re : [Résolu] Serveur web localhost, comment fait-on ?

bendia a écrit :

otyugh a écrit :

Fais en un article dans le wiki si tu penses pourvoir l'expliquer à la prochaine personne avec ce besoin

Nous en sommes en plein dans la mise à jour du wiki et on peut voir sur la page Etat du Wiki qu'il y a un tuto sur LAMP en chantier depuis 2019 qui aurait probablement besoin d'être repris avec les dernières infos sur les logiciels mis en œuvre et terminé afin d'être placé smile



Bonjour,
juste pour signaler que le lien vers le tuto LAMP n'est pas bon. Je l'ai trouvé et il me sera bien utile.

Pour participer au wiki, je compte apprendre et en effet pourquoi pas ?


Aucune idole, vivante, statufiée ou immatérielle.
Xfce, style Numix, icônes Tango

Hors ligne

#15 29-04-2023 20:08:59

Neuromancien
Membre
Inscription : 03-02-2015

Re : [Résolu] Serveur web localhost, comment fait-on ?

Hello,

Tu peux te baser sur cet article. Il est encore valable pour Bullseye avec PHP 7.4.

Hors ligne

#16 29-04-2023 20:15:23

brennux
Adhérent(e)
Lieu : France
Distrib. : Debian-facile 11 (bullseye)
Noyau : 5.10.0-26-amd64
(G)UI : Xfce
Inscription : 21-04-2020

Re : [Résolu] Serveur web localhost, comment fait-on ?

Neuromancien a écrit :

Hello,

Tu peux te baser sur cet article. Il est encore valable pour Bullseye avec PHP 7.4.


Bonjour,
merci ! Je ne manque pas de tutoriel, si avec ça je n'y arrive pas…


Aucune idole, vivante, statufiée ou immatérielle.
Xfce, style Numix, icônes Tango

Hors ligne

#17 30-04-2023 01:45:48

otyugh
CA Debian-Facile
Lieu : Quimperlé/Arzano
Distrib. : Debian Stable
Inscription : 20-09-2016
Site Web

Re : [Résolu] Serveur web localhost, comment fait-on ?

brennux a écrit :

si avec ça je n'y arrive pas…


...C'est que les tutoriels sont vraiment pas adaptés wink


virtue_signaling.pngpalestine.png
~1821942.svg

Hors ligne

#18 14-07-2023 18:37:06

brennux
Adhérent(e)
Lieu : France
Distrib. : Debian-facile 11 (bullseye)
Noyau : 5.10.0-26-amd64
(G)UI : Xfce
Inscription : 21-04-2020

Re : [Résolu] Serveur web localhost, comment fait-on ?

Bonjour,
un petit retour pour remercier tout le monde. Mes premiers pas ayant été bien orientés, j'ai pu trouver des explications compréhensibles.

Le serveur est installé et actif. Me reste à parcourir l'étape suivante pour avoir mes maquettes locales installées au bon endroit et opérationnelles.
Je reviendrai probablement avec de nouvelles questions.

Aucune idole, vivante, statufiée ou immatérielle.
Xfce, style Numix, icônes Tango

Hors ligne

Pied de page des forums